The sandbox video game ‘Minecraft’ has been a huge hit since 2011 and is even considered the best-selling video game of all time. Millions of players spend hours immersed in the world of blocks to build the largest structures and landscapes. Previously you only played the character Steve (now you can choose others too). As you walk through the world with this, chopping things away, putting other things down. Now there’s a ‘Minecraft’ movie currently filming in New Zealand. Jack Black leads the illustrious cast that includes ‘Aquaman’ Jason Moma, comedian Kate McKinnon, Danielle Brooks of ‘Orange Is The New Black’ and ‘The White Lotus’ star Jennifer Coolidge. Jack Black, known as a passionate gamer from his own YouTube Let’s Plays, claims that that he currently plays “Minecraft” around the clock. When there is no filming, he turns on the game. After all, that is his duty: “An actor prepares.”
Jack Black’s “Minecraft” prep: learning to hack through gaming
“I want to be in full Minecraft mode. I want to know the rule and I want to do little things right – things like, ‘Oh, in the game this is how you use the pick, you hit things like this.’ I do the same in the film. I think the Academy members will appreciate my preparation later. I don’t want to jinx it, but I’m pretty sure I’m getting an Oscar for this movie.
Of course, Jack Black’s comments shouldn’t be taken entirely seriously, but the millions of “Minecraft” fans around the world should be happy that someone with a deep passion for the brand and the world of video games is involved with the film. ‘Minecraft’ is directed by Jared Hess, who already recorded ‘Nacho Libre’ with Black and is also known for ‘Napoleon Dynamite’, among others.
theatrical release of “Minecraft“ is April 3, 2025.
